COMMERCIAL DESCRIPTION
A golden, glittering strong pale ale, well balanced and with a European combination of Slovenian hops and a unique German finish

Beaten gold with a greenish tint, slight mist and a slim white halo. Gelatinous citrus-flavoured confectionary aroma of Jelly Tots and Rowntree’s pineapple jelly, with a greener tomato leaf undercurrent that’s pushing an 8. Bright floral/squeeze of lime hop, bitter peanut bite, grass and celery muskiness joining the party. JHB but more so. Fine husky peanut brittle afters. Massive relief after a clutch of murky BC stinkers; crisp uncomplicated GA slugged back with relish. Sink got none.

Nov 2009: Brown 500ml bottle poured into a pint glass, vase shaped and ’Old Speckled Hen’ badged. Very pale, lager looking, the labelling did say ’Pilsner type ale’. Huge white head sat on top of a clear golden lager look-a-like beer, full of life, bubbles rising through the body and clear to see. Slovenian hops used, but not named, whatever they are they don’t give anything to the aroma, which was almost non-existant apart from some sweet malted biscuit notes. A blend between a pilsner and a UK pale ale, certainly different and challanging to the palat. Your eyes say lager, your tastebuds say ale. Well carbonated, which doesn’t help the mind sort out the flavours from lager to ale. Yet again a good value product from Barnsley Beer, they don’t pretent to be classy and their prices are very keen, another winner in my opinion.

Bottle from Rhythm & Booze, Barton upon Humber. Gold, thin shortlived white head and low condition. Gentle caramel and banana in the nose, with a slight flowery hop note, good solid honeyed Bohemian hop note in the mouth with a delicate sweet maltiness and traces of caramel re-emerging with time, lingering chalky hop bitterness in the finish with more maltiness briefly shining.
